Walmart Inc. (WMT) said it is suspending the sale of all over the counter ranitidine products in stores, clubs and online, including Zantac, Equate and Member's Mark brands.

The company said it is taking this action after closely monitoring the recent product alert from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ration that ranitidine products may contain a low level of nitrosodimethylamine, or NDMA.

NDMA is classified as a probable human carcinogen.

Customers who purchased these products may return them to Walmart or Sam's Club for a refund, the retail company said.

CVS Health Corp. (CVS) said Saturday it suspended the sale of all Zantac brand and CVS Health brand ranitidine products, citing the FDA product alert.
